Common questions about hiring a babysitter in Steubenville, OH

The average rate for babysitters in Steubenville, OH on Care.com is $18.00 per hour as of September 2026. Rates can vary depending on the babysitter’s experience, the ages of your children, and the types of responsibilities you need help with. Duties like preparing meals, handling bedtime routines, caring for infants, or supervising multiple children may influence the overall rate. Many families also find that evening, weekend, or last-minute care can be priced differently. Babysitters typically provide occasional or part-time care, such as evenings, weekends, or short-term help when parents are away. Nannies usually work more consistent hours and may take on additional responsibilities like planning activities, helping with children’s schedules, or supporting daily routines. Understanding the differences can help you decide which type of caregiver best fits your family’s needs in Steubenville.
How early you should book a babysitter depends on when and how long you need care. For busy times like weekends, holidays, or evenings, it can help to reach out several days in advance. If you need ongoing or recurring help, contacting sitters ahead of time gives you more options and allows you to schedule interviews and meet-and-greets. For last-minute care, many babysitters in Steubenville offer flexible or same-day availability.
